🍋 Lemon Juice

What It Is

  • Lemon juice is the liquid extracted from fresh lemons.
  • It has a bright, tangy, acidic flavor and contains citric acid, vitamin C, and antioxidants.

Culinary Uses

  1. Flavoring & Marinades
    • Adds brightness to salads, fish, chicken, or vegetables.
    • Used in marinades to tenderize meat.
  2. Baking
    • Balances sweetness in cakes, cookies, and frostings.
    • Reacts with baking soda to help baked goods rise.
  3. Beverages
    • Lemonade, cocktails, teas, and sparkling water.
  4. Preserving
    • Prevents fruits like apples, pears, and avocados from browning.

Health Benefits

  • Rich in vitamin C for immune support.
  • Supports digestion and may help prevent kidney stones.
  • Contains antioxidants that combat free radicals.

Tips

  • Fresh is best for flavor; bottled juice is convenient but can have preservatives and less brightness.
  • Store leftover juice in a sealed container in the fridge for up to 3–4 days.
  • Freeze in ice cube trays for easy single-use portions.
